Chandigarh, May 11 -- In a two-pronged attack on Monday, unidentified individuals targeted two offices of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) in Punjab, leading to significant property damage and widespread panic. Incidents of vandalism and stone-pelting were reported from the party's establishments in Zirakpur (Mohali) and Tarn Taran, causing tension to escalate across the region.
In Tarn Taran, a mob comprising approximately 15 to 20 armed individuals stormed the BJP district headquarters during the afternoon. According to BJP district president Harjeet Singh Sandhu, the attackers, carrying sticks and batons, damaged furniture and pelted stones while raising slogans against the party.
